622Mb/s Fiber Optic Post
Amplifier
The SX1125 is an integrated limiting amplifier for high frequency fiber
optic applications. The device interfaces directly to the trans–impedance
amplifier of a typical optical to electrical conversion portion of a fiber optic
link. With data rate capabilities in the 622Mb/s range, the high gain
limiting amplification of the SX1125 is ideal for high speed fiber optic
applications like SONET/SDM, ATM, FDDI, Fibre Channel or Serial Hippi.
The device is functionally and pin compatible to the Signetics SA5225
with a significantly higher bandwidth. The CAZP and CAZN inputs to the
limiting amplifier provide an auto-zero function to effectively cancel any
input offset voltage present in the amplifier.
The SX1125 incorporates a programmable level detect function to
identify when the input signal has been lost. This information can be fed
back to the Disable input of the device to maintain stability under loss of
signal conditions. Using the Vset pin the sensitivity of the level detect can
be adjusted. The CLD input is used to filter the level detect input so that
random noise spikes are filtered out.
The MC10SX1125 is compatible with MECL10H logic levels.
• Wideband Operation: 20kHz to 550MHz
• Programmable Input Signal Level Detection
• Operation with single +5V or standard ECL supply
• Standard 16-lead SOIC Package
• Fully Differential Design to Minimize Noise Affects
• 10KH Compatible
